# Installation Guide

1. Get the code
git clone https://github.com/RightNow-AI/openfang

Downloads the entire project code from GitHub to your computer.

cd openfang

Moves into the project folder you just downloaded.

2. Official Install Script

Easy Recommended
curl -fsSL https://openfang.sh/install | sh

Downloads and runs the official install script in one line β€” this handles the full setup automatically.

irm https://openfang.sh/install.ps1 | iex

Downloads and runs the official install script via PowerShell β€” this handles the full setup automatically.

βœ… After installing, open a new terminal and run the program's version command (e.g. --version) to confirm it worked.

6. Rust

Medium
Prerequisites
  • Git Needed to download the project code from GitHub.
  • Rust (rustup) Installing via rustup also installs cargo.
cargo build --workspace --lib

Compiles the Rust project.

cargo test --workspace

Type this command into your terminal and run it.

cargo clippy --workspace --all-targets -- -D warnings

Type this command into your terminal and run it.

cargo fmt --all -- --check

Type this command into your terminal and run it.

βœ… If cargo build finishes without errors, it worked. The executable is created under target/.
